Transaction 2899e90e755e22bb3ebbdf4676400196f9523b7f5d134629f76027a2b3e31996

1 Input
1 Outputs
  • 2899e90e755e22bb3ebbdf4676400196f9523b7f5d134629f76027a2b3e31996:0
  • value  103471
    address  1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z